thereisnotry wrote:
Yes, I've said it before: the OR really doesn't need a lot of CEs to be strong in 500, but the other factions do. Vong and Mandos especially.
I'm also thinking that 75pt Gambit might be a bit much, since Tim's squad (Exar, Bane, Krayt) would still be able to win fairly easily just by holding gambit. After 5 rounds he'd have 375pts, which means that those huge damage-dealers would just have to kill a couple of pieces (not hard to do, especially with the Swoop Bike's range and Exar's TE-triple-attack) to win. If Josh hadn't used Kavar to Sever Force in their game, Tim would've won the whole tournament without a problem. The purpose of big-epic gambit is to encourage epic-on-epic combat in the middle...not to give one squad-type an almost auto-win situation.
Therefore, IMHO 50pt gambit, gainable only by epics, might be the way to go instead. With that in place though, you might also have to also decide that if you win with 400+ (or maybe 350+) pts you get the full 3pt win.
